Average Household Income

Whenever we ask what is the average household income in Belleview CCD, we are actually talking about the mean household income.

This is calculated by adding up all the incomes of all the households in Belleview CCD, and then dividing that number by the total number of households. This is a good way to get a general idea of the average income of a group of people, but it can be skewed by a very high or very low incomes.

The average household income of Belleview CCD, West Virginia is currently $68,507.00.

In terms of accurately summarizing income at a geographic level, the median income is a better metric than the average income because it isn't affected by a small number of very high or very low incomes.

If you had an area where the average income was greater than the median, it can mean that there is significant income inequality, with income being concentrated in a small number of wealthy households.

Per Capita Income

The per capita income in Belleview CCD is $29,819.00.

Per capita income is the average income of a person in a given area. It is calculated by dividing the total income of Belleview CCD by the total population of Belleview CCD.

This is different from the average or mean income because it includes and accounts for all people in Belleview CCD, West Virginia, including people like children, the elderly, unemployed people, retired people, and more.
